So far I haven't had to mess with the DOT during this 72 hour blitz. I don't think all the states are doing 72 hour deal. It wouldn't matter to me if I get checked because it's $30 in my pocket for a clean inspection. Drivers always complain about getting pulled around at the scale and getting an inspection done. Yes it is time consuming, but what isn't. I've been pulled around many times over the years and only ran across one cop in Wyoming that had a real attitude. All the others I've had no problems with. In fact most are willing to joke around with me. No sense getting all worked up over it. I have seen other drivers come in all pissed off and the cops will know before the guy gets to the counter what they are going to do. They will get me done quick and then start on the one with the attitude. They will take their little old time and thoroughly go over everything,truck trailer and paperwork. The driver will be stuck there for a long time!
